Cranberry Chicken

Posted by bettyboop50 at recipegoldmine.com May 2, 2001

1 can whole cranberry sauce
1 (8 ounce) bottle Catalina salad dressing
Chicken breasts, skinless and boneless

Preheat oven to 350 degrees F.

Place chicken breasts in a 9 x 13-inch baking pan.

Combine cranberry sauce and salad dressing. Pour over chicken breasts and bake for about 45 minutes.

Servings: 4

Cranberry Chicken

4 boneless, skinless chicken breast halves
1 can whole cranberry sauce
2/3 cup chili sauce
2 tablespoons cider vinegar
2 tablespoons brown sugar
1 envelope dry onion soup mix

Place chicken breasts in crockpot.

Combine remaining ingredients; add to crockpot, coating chicken well. Cover and cook on LOW for 6 to 8 hours.

Serves 4 to 6.

Cranberry Chicken

Serves: 4

1 chicken, cut up
1 (16 ounce) can whole berry cranberry sauce
1 (8 ounce) bottle Russian Dressing
1 package onion soup mix

Put chicken into a crockpot. Mix remaining ingredients together. Pour over chicken. Cook on LOW for 7 to 8 hours until chicken is well done.

Serve with white rice.

Cranberry Chicken

1 chicken, cut up (or your favorite parts)
3/4 cup chopped onions
1 cup fresh cranberries (washed and sorted)
1 teaspoon salt
1/4 teaspoon cinnamon
1/4 teaspoon ginger
1 teaspoon grated orange rind
1 cup orange juice
3 tablespoons melted butter or margarine
3 tablespoons all-purpose flour
3 tablespoons brown sugar

Remove skin from chicken. Place in the crockpot with onion, cranberries, salt, cinnamon, ginger, orange rind and orange juice. Cover and cook on LOW for 5 to 6 hours.

Remove chicken from pot and separate meat from bone; set aside.

Melt butter in a skillet, add flour and cook into a roux. Stir into liquid in crockpot to thicken. Add chicken meat and brown sugar; stir to combine.

This is great served with rice!

Cranberry Chicken

8 boneless chicken breasts
1 can cranberry sauce
1 bottle French dressing
1 envelope onion soup mix

Brown chicken breasts, then place in casserole dish. Mix cranberry sauce, dressing and soup mix; pour sauce over chicken breasts. Bake at 350 degrees F for 1 1/2 hours or until chicken is done.
